The drug stops tumor growth and causes it to die

Lobachevsky University of Nizhny Novgorod (UNN) has created an effective drug to fight cancer. Scientists combined several active molecules in one drug, which made it possible to carry out combined photodynamic (PDT) and chemotherapy for oncological diseases, the university's press service said.

Associate Professor of the Department of Organic Chemistry of the Faculty of Chemistry of UNN, Vasily Otvagin, said that the drug was created on the basis of proven components. It includes green algae, a photosensitizer (a substance that increases the body's sensitivity to visible radiation), the chemotherapy drug "Cabozantinib" and an analogue of photoditazine (a second-generation photosensitizer for photodynamic therapy).

The linker (molecular fragment) is sensitive to the enzyme glucuronidase, which accumulates in tumors. Reaching a cancer cell, the drug breaks down into components. The photosensitizer destroys the tumor, and the chemotherapy drug eliminates the remaining cancer-affected tissues.

The high selectivity of the created molecule is realized through the use of a special linker-bundle that breaks down inside tumor tissues.

This combination of components increases the effectiveness of the drug. Scientists confirmed their findings during experiments on cell cultures.
